1. **Set Limits and Boundaries** It's important for parents to establish clear boundaries when it comes to Gaming. Encourage your children to have designated gaming hours and make sure they understand that gaming should not interfere with their schoolwork, social life, or physical activities. Setting limits will help promote a healthy balance between gaming and other aspects of their lives. 2. **Encourage Social Interaction** Gaming can sometimes be a solitary activity, so it's important to encourage your children to also engage in social interactions. Encourage them to play multiplayer games with friends either online or in person. Additionally, participating in gaming events or joining local gaming communities in Copenhagen can help them connect with like-minded individuals and develop social skills. 3. **Monitor Content** As a parent, it's essential to monitor the content of the games your children are playing. Make sure the games are age-appropriate and do not contain any violent or inappropriate content. Take some time to play the games yourself or read reviews to ensure they align with your family values. 4. **Educate About Online Safety** With online gaming becoming increasingly popular, it's crucial to educate your children about online safety. Teach them about the importance of not sharing personal information, interacting with strangers, and being cautious about in-game purchases. Set up parental controls on gaming devices to enhance online safety. 5. **Encourage Physical Activity** Gaming is a sedentary activity, so it's essential to balance it with physical exercise. Encourage your children to take breaks during gaming sessions to stretch, go for a walk, or engage in physical activities. Copenhagen offers a wide range of outdoor spaces and sports facilities where families can enjoy activities together. 6. **Lead By Example** Children often mimic their parents' behavior, so set a positive example when it comes to gaming habits. Show your children that you can enjoy gaming in moderation while also prioritizing other aspects of your life. Engage in gaming sessions together as a family bonding activity. By following these tips and advice, parents in Copenhagen can support their children's interest in gaming while ensuring a healthy and balanced approach.
